NZ Cricket sorry for racist abuse toward Archer
New Zealand Cricket will contact Jofra Archer to apologize after a fan racially abused the England fast bowler at the end of the first test at Bay Oval in Mount Maunganui, it said yesterday.
The governing body said in a statement that Archer, who is black, was abused as he left the field after New Zealand clinched victory by an innings and 65 runs on Sunday. It was unable to locate the person who hurled the racial abuse and will be making further inquiries today. NZC said it was an 鈥渦nacceptable experience鈥 for Archer and promised 鈥渋ncreased vigilance in the matter鈥 for the second test in Hamilton. The England and Wales Cricket Board said it was also looking into the matter. The 24-year-old Archer tweeted about the incident, saying it was a 鈥渂it disturbing hearing racial insults today whilst battling to help save my team鈥.
